English Current News

  1. The Goods and Services Tax (GST) Council Tuesday decided to impose a 28 per cent tax on the turnover of online gaming companies, horse racing and casinos.

  2. The Supreme Court Tuesday held as ‘illegal’ two successive extensions of one year each granted to Enforcement Directorate (ED) chief Sanjay Kumar Mishra, holding that the Centre’s orders were in ‘breach’ of its mandamus in its 2021 verdict that the IRS officer should not be given further term.

  3. The Supreme Court Tuesday said it will commence day to-day hearing from August 2 on a batch of petitions challenging abrogation of Article 370 of the Constitution.  

  4. In an attempt to provide more convenience to car users at City airport, Airtel Payments Bank has collaborated with Park+ to enable FASTag-based smart parking solution at the Biju Patnaik International Airport (BPIA) here.

  5. The state of Odisha Tuesday raised objection over the inclusion of western catchment area as part of Mahanadi basin in the common information format (CIF) prepared by the assessors.

  6. As part of its continued efforts to strengthen higher secondary education, the state government Tuesday approved creation of 902 new posts in higher secondary schools across Odisha.

  7. Bharatiya Janata Party's Goa unit president Sadanand Shet Tanavade Tuesday filed his nomination papers for the election to the lone Rajya Sabha seat from the coastal state. The Rajya Sabha election would be held July 24.

  8. NATO leaders agreed Tuesday to allow Ukraine to join “when allies agree and conditions are met,” the head of the military alliance said, hours after President Volodymyr Zelenskyy blasted the organisation’s failure to set a timetable for his country as “absurd.”

  9. Indonesia's coast guard said Tuesday it seized an Iranian-flagged supertanker suspected of involvement in the illegal transshipment of crude oil, and vowed to toughen maritime patrols.

  10. Consumer Affairs, Food and Public Distribution Ministry has said that the decision to sell rice through e-auction under the Open Market Sale Scheme (OMSS) from the buffer stock to bulk consumers has been taken in the public interest.

  11. Rajasthan Chief Minister Ashok Gehlot has approved a proposal for starting the Teacher Interface for Excellence (TIE) programme, as part of which the teachers of government universities, colleges and polytechnic colleges will get training in prestigious institutions of the country and abroad. 

  12. China and the Solomon Islands on Monday signed a deal on police cooperation as part of an upgrade of their relations to a “comprehensive strategic partnership,” four years after the Pacific nation switched ties from Taiwan to China. 

  13. Dutch Prime Minister Mark Rutte announced on Monday he was quitting politics after nearly 13 years in power, in a shock end to his time as the longest-serving leader in the history of the Netherlands. 

  14. Athletics Federation of India has been adjudged as the best member federation in Asia by Asian Athletics Association. 

  15. World number 42 Marketa Vondrousova defeated world number four Jessica Pegula 6-4, 2-6, 6-4 to reach the Wimbledon semi-finals for the first time.
